Where You’ll Work

Founded in 1941, Dignity Health - Dominican Hospital is a 188-bed, acute care, nonprofit hospital located in Santa Cruz, California. Serving over 80,000 patients annually, the hospital offers a full complement of services including heart care, orthopedics, and a Family Birthing Center. Additionally, Dominican Hospital has been recognized as an LGBTQ+ Healthcare Equality High Performer by the Human Rights Campaign Foundation. It is a Joint Commission-certified Primary Stroke Center, and has been awarded the AMA/ASA’s Get the Guidelines - Stroke Gold Plus Quality Achievement, recognizing the hospital’s commitment to providing the best stroke care.

Job Summary and Responsibilities

As a Charge Nurse, you'll oversee a department of frontline nurses caring for patients. Your previous experience in acute care, LTC, or nursing homes adds tremendous value to our nursing team.Every day you will advocate for your fellow nurses as you support them in reaching their full potential, which aligns with your department's operational goals and objectives.To thrive in this role, you need to be accountable and confident. You're an excellent communicator in 1:1 interactions and in front of groups. It's also important for you to be comfortable holding tough conversations, as you are responsible for the performance of your people and your unit.

  • Acts as a clinical resource and serves as a mentor to health care team members. Models clinical excellence. Displays leadership behaviors.
  • Models and ensures standards for professional staff behavior in the department. Models professional behavior and collaboration for staff. Actively supports leadership in shared goals
  • Able to assign staff appropriately. Works collaboratively with Nursing Supervisor on staffing decisions. Flexes staff to meet matrix and census levels. Assigns breaks and lunches to staff and ensures compliance. Takes actions to ensure staff is able to complete patient care within limits of shift. Reviews and maintains supply usage.
  • Knowledgeable of all regulatory agency standards including safe medication standards for patient and staff requirements. Assists with educating staff to all applicable standards. Monitors for staff compliance and adherence to requirements. Conducts or assigns audits to ensure compliance. Reviews pharmacy discrepancy reports every 4 hours and works with staff involved to clear Does not leave shift without a final clear discrepancy report from Omnicell.
  • Uses applicable computer programs to enhance patient and employee communication. Proficient in Nursing/Unit specific programs and systems. Utilizes acuity and timekeeping systems as needed.
  • Influences and supports staff to expand professional development in their area of practice. Assists with assessing the learning needs of staff members and suggest resources to meet the needs. Contributes to the delivery of new processes for staff and ensures compliance.
